Who it's for
- Aggressive trail riders seeking reliable traction on varied terrain.
- Enduro and all-mountain riders prioritizing tire resilience.
- Mountain bikers desiring predictable performance and control.
Who should skip it
- Cross-country riders or those prioritizing pedaling efficiency.
- Weight-conscious riders or those seeking a nimble, lightweight setup.
- Home mechanics or riders without specialized tire levers.
Performance breakdown
Cornering Grip
Aggressive side knobs bite hard into loose corners with total confidence.
Braking Traction
Predictable stopping power even on steep, loose, or muddy descents.
Casing Durability
Gravity Shield construction shrugs off sharp rocks and trail debris easily.
Rolling Efficiency
The aggressive tread pattern creates noticeable drag on smooth, hardpack climbs.
Tubeless Setup
Seats quickly and holds air reliably with minimal sealant seepage.
Weight Penalty
Heavier than race-focused tires, but the trade-off favors rugged trail reliability.
Key Specs
Size
29 x 2.6 inches
Weight
1130 grams
Compound
Gum-X
Bead Type
Folding
Tire Type
Tubeless
Intended Use
All Mountain
Puncture Protection
Yes (Gravity Shield)
Tubeless Ready
Yes
